A Professional Certificate in Math for Biomedical Engineering equips students with the essential mathematical foundations crucial for success in this interdisciplinary field. The program focuses on developing a strong understanding of core mathematical concepts directly applicable to biomedical engineering challenges.
Learning outcomes typically include proficiency in calculus, linear algebra, differential equations, and probability and statistics. Students gain expertise in applying these mathematical tools to model biological systems, analyze medical images, and design biomedical devices. This strong mathematical base is vital for advanced studies and research within biomedical engineering.
The duration of a Professional Certificate in Math for Biomedical Engineering program varies depending on the institution, but generally ranges from a few months to a year of intensive study. Some programs offer flexible online learning options, while others may be delivered in a traditional classroom setting. The specific curriculum and delivery method should be confirmed with the offering institution.
